The PSRmini product range comprises a total of 28 products in 6-mm and 12-mm versions. Despite the narrow design, the products offer maximum performance: they switch loads of up to 6 A, are compatible with many signal transmitters and safety-related controllers, are versatile, thanks to comprehensive approvals, and much more.

The compact design quickly pays for itself, as numerous signals can be processed in a confined space, thereby utilizing the space in the control cabinet to optimum effect. The fine-grained architecture makes a modular design of safety concepts possible: the 6-mm version is available with one to two enabling contacts, and two to three enabling contacts with the 12-mm version.

Groundbreaking: new relay technology from Phoenix Contact

The centerpiece of the new PSRmini device family is the relay technology developed by our engineers. Only 6-mm wide, this elementary relay with force-guided contacts features numerous technological details and is as reliable as safety technology should be. Its robustness, reliability, and diagnostic capability sets it apart from a standard elementary relay.

In order to ensure high production accuracy and to meet our stringent quality requirements, the elementary relay and all of its individual parts are manufactured by Phoenix Contact.

Full SIL3 performance in potentially explosive areas

Full SIL3 performance in potentially explosive areas

The safe PSRmini coupling relays are used for signal amplification and electrical isolation in conjunction with the outputs of a safety controller. Adapted to the relevant process control systems, the new product range offers SIL-certified coupling modules for safe deactivation (Emergency Shut-Down) and safe activation (Fire and Gas).

In addition to reduced space and material requirements, PSRmini offers plenty of other advantages:

  • Shorter downtimes during scheduled maintenance phases, thanks to simple, fast diagnostics directly at the device or the controller
  • Use of safe coupling relays in potentially explosive areas for the creation of distributed concepts
  • System cabling using customer-specific termination carriers for fast, error-free startup and connection in the field
